Pete,
I think that I may have approached this company about the possibility of making repro tyres for the Daimler Dingo. It seems the company gets there tyres made for them in the Far East, labour and costs are low. They told me that to make a mould for a tyre would be about £25,000 before the cost of the tyre and with a minimum run of 200 tyres. It does mean that a lot of money has to be put up front before anything will happen. Certainly worth pursueing though.
